Just Play The Music! Multiple Sources Welcome: Toma.hk API

Candice McMillan, May 13th, 2013

Toma.hkFor music fans who enjoy listening to playlists on their laptops or desktops, Tomahawk is a music player with a few extra bells and whistles that may be of some interest. It’s an open-source, cross-platform music player, which means it enables a user to play music stored on their own hard drives as well as from a variety of other music sources like Spotify, SoundCloud, YouTube and more. The Toma.hk API makes this functionality available to developers or users to add songs to websites.

The Wevideo API: Editing and Storyboard Tools at Your Fingertips

Greg Bates, April 29th, 2013

WeVideoThe Wevideo API opens up this video-editing-in-the-cloud service. Technical information on the API is available directly from the company.  Wevideo provides a solid set of editing and storyboard tools including a timeline and a library of soundtracks. Beyond that, the cloud gives movie editors something else: the ability to collaborate with ease. Because you can create copies of footage, different people can edit the same video as they please.
